Buying Guide

What occasion are you shopping for?

For bridal events, prioritize satin or structured fabrics that photograph well and hold shape. For beach or vacation looks, breathable blends with a slight stretch improve comfort in heat. For sleepwear or loungewear tied to wedding-day prep, consider softer, more forgiving fabrics and relaxed fits.

Which fabric matters most?

Satin and polyester blends provide a formal sheen and drape, suitable for photos. Cotton-rich or lightweight polyester blends offer better breathability for warm days or travel. Consider whether you need moisture-wicking or wrinkle resistance for your plans.

How important is support and coverage?

Backless or halter styles look chic but may require strategic undergarments. If you want secure support, choose tops with built-in structure or plan for tailored alterations. For stage or photos, test movement to ensure coverage remains consistent.

Is versatility a priority?

Two-piece sets that mix and match with other pieces let you rewear outfits beyond the event. Neutral tones and minimalist silhouettes often pair with different accessories to extend wearability.

What about sizing and fit?

Review size charts for each brand, noting that stretch fabrics can accommodate minor size fluctuations. If between sizes, consider the fit of the top versus the skirt to balance overall proportions.

FAQ

  1. What should I wear under a backless or halter top?

    Choose strapless bras or silicone nipple covers, and consider fashion tape for secure placement to avoid shifting.

  2. Are white sets appropriate for all bridal events?

    White styles work well for bridal-themed shoots and casual wedding events, but check the venue dress code and season.

  3. Can these sets be mixed and matched with other pieces?

    Yes. Pair the tops with separate skirts or swap skirts to create multiple looks and maximize wearability.

  4. Do these outfits require ironing or steaming?

    Most satin and polyester blends respond well to light steaming to remove creases; avoid high-heat ironing on delicate fabrics.

  5. Which set is best for photoshoots?

    Satin maxi or one-shoulder sets with clean lines tend to photograph well in natural light and studio settings.

  6. Are these outfits comfortable for long events?

    Fabric blends with light stretch and elastic waistbands offer better day-long comfort for standing or walking sessions.
